In order to take Kaplan University online classes, students need a personal computer (PC) with a modem and access to the Internet. This program incorporates the use of email, discussion board postings, and navigation of the Internet for Web Field Trips. The use of Microsoft® Word documents for a Learning Journal is recommended.
Hardware:
- A computer capable of running Windows 7, Windows XP or Vista, or Mac OS X* with the operating system’s minimum requirements for processor, memory, and hard drive (See the Microsoft or Apple website for minimum requirements)
*Medical Coding Certificate students may not use Mac computers.
- At least 10.0 GB of free hard-drive space (additional space may be needed for multimedia files)
- 1024 x 768 monitor with a 16-bit or greater video card (24-bit preferred)
- DVD-ROM drive or CD-ROM drive (Medical Coding Certificate students are required to have both)
- A dedicated, reliable 128 Kbps or faster Internet connection
- PC capable of playing sound with speakers
